## Who We Are: Neurocrine Biosciences is a leading biopharmaceutical company with a simple purpose: to relieve suffering for people with great needs. We are dedicated to discovering, developing and commercializing life-changing treatments for patients with under-addressed neurological, psychiatric, endocrine and immunological disorders. The company's diverse portfolio includes FDA-approved treatments for tardive dyskinesia, chorea associated with Huntington's disease, classic congenital adrenal hyperplasia, hyperphagia in patients with Prader-Willi syndrome, endometriosis\* and uterine fibroids\*, as well as a robust pipeline including multiple compounds in mid- to late-phase clinical development across our core therapeutic areas. For more than three decades, we have applied our unique insight into neuroscience and the interconnections between brain and body systems to treat complex conditions. We relentlessly pursue medicines to ease the burden of debilitating diseases and disorders, because you deserve brave science. (*\*in collaboration with AbbVie*) ## About the Role: We are seeking a highly motivated professional to strengthen our healthcare compliance program through data-driven monitoring and analytics. This role will focus on translating regulatory requirements and risk insights into actionable dashboards, key risk indicators (KRIs), and reporting that support effective oversight of commercial activities. \_ ## Your Contributions (include, but are not limited to): - Design and execute data-driven compliance monitoring initiatives aligned with organizational priorities - Translate healthcare compliance requirements into measurable monitoring frameworks, KRIs, and reporting tools - Develop and maintain dashboards (Power BI, Tableau, or similar) to deliver actionable insights to Compliance leadership - Analyze data to identify trends, risks, and opportunities to enhance compliance oversight - Partner cross-functionally with Compliance, Legal, and Commercial teams to improve monitoring effectiveness ## Requirements: -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ent experience) with 6+ years in pharmaceutical, biotech, or medical device industries - Understanding of U.S. healthcare compliance laws and regulations (e.g., promotional practices, interactions with HCPs) - Compliance & Ethics Professional (CCEP) certification preferred - Experience in compliance, monitoring, analytics, or commercial operations - Strong expertise in building dashboards and data visualizations using Power BI, Tableau, or similar tools - Strong analytical, communication, and organizational skills with attention to detail -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ities. - Experience developing key risk indicators (KRIs) and compliance reporting frameworks - 0-5% U.S. travel required #LI-TM1 Neurocrine Biosciences is an EEO/Disability/Vets…
